| Specification | Tecno Spark 30 5G | Tecno Spark 40C |
|---|---|---|
| Price in Pakistan | ||
| Retail price | PKR 49,999 | PKR 35,999 Cheaper |
| Design & build | ||
| Release date | September 2024 | September 2025 |
| Dimensions | 165 x 77 x 7.8 mm | 165.6 × 77.0 × 8.37 mm |
| Weight | 188.5 g | Not officially specified |
| Water resistance | IP54 dust and splash resistant | IP64 (Dust Tight & Splash Resistant) |
| Display | ||
| Screen size | 6.67 inches | 6.67 inches |
| Resolution | 720 × 1600 pixels (HD+) | 720 × 1600 pixels (HD+) |
| Panel type | IPS LCD 120Hz Up to 700 nits (High Brightness Mode) | IPS LCD 120Hz |
| Protection | No official display protection announced | Panda Glass |
| Performance | ||
| Chipset | MediaTek Dimensity 6300 (6nm) | MediaTek Helio G81 (12nm) |
| CPU | Octa-core 2 × Cortex-A76 2.4 GHz 6 × Cortex-A55 2.0 GHz | Octa-core 2 × Cortex-A75 @ 2.0GHz 6 × Cortex-A55 @ 1.8GHz |
| GPU | Mali-G57 MC2 | Mali-G52 MC2 |
| Operating system | Android 14 with HiOS 14 | Android 15 HiOS 15 |
| Memory & storage | ||
| RAM | 6GB / 8GB Supported (Memory Fusion technology, up to 8GB extended RAM depending on the variant) | 4GB / 8GB LPDDR4X (Memory Fusion (Virtual RAM) Up to 8GB Extended RAM, depending on the variant) |
| Internal storage | 128GB / 256GB UFS 2.2 | 128GB / 256GB eMMC 5.1 |
| Card slot | microSDXC (dedicated slot) | Dedicated microSD card slot Expandable storage up to 1TB (market dependent) |
| Camera | ||
| Main camera | 108 MP, f/1.8, PDAF Auxiliary sensor Triple LED Flash HDR Panorama Better | 13 MP, Wide AI Lens Dual LED Flash HDR Panorama AI Scene Recognition Portrait Mode Night Mode Beauty Mode Pro Mode |
| Selfie camera | 8 MP Dual-LED Flash | 8 MP Dual Front Flash AI Beauty Portrait Mode HDR Face Retouch Smile Capture Gesture Capture Filters |
| Video recording | 1080p at 30fps | 1080p @ 30fps 720p @ 30fps |
| Battery & charging | ||
| Battery capacity | Li-Ion (non-removable) 5000 mAh | Li-Ion (non-removable) 6000 mAh Better |
| Wired charging | 18W Wired Fast Charging | 18W Fast Charging |
| Connectivity & extras | ||
| SIM | Dual Nano-SIM, Dual Standby (Dual SIM) | Dual Nano-SIM, Dual Standby (Dual SIM) |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ac Dual-band Wi-Fi Wi-Fi Direct |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ac Dual-band Wi-Fi Wi-Fi Direct Wi-Fi Hotspot |
| Bluetooth | 5.3 A2DP LE | 5.0 A2DP LE |
| NFC | Yes | Yes |
| Sensors | Side-mounted Fingerprint Sensor Accelerometer Proximity Sensor Compass Ambient Light Sensor Virtual Gyroscope | Side-mounted Fingerprint Scanner Face Unlock Accelerometer Ambient Light Sensor Proximity Sensor Electronic Compass Virtual Gyroscope Infrared Remote Sensor |
| USB |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G | USB Type-C 2.0, OTG |

Tecno Spark 30 5G is listed at PKR 49,999 and Tecno Spark 40C at PKR 35,999. That makes Tecno Spark 40C cheaper by PKR 14,000. Retail prices move often, so treat these as indicative.
Tecno Spark 30 5G scores higher in our camera assessment. Tecno Spark 30 5G uses a 108 MP main sensor against 13 MP on Tecno Spark 40C, though sensor size and processing matter more than resolution alone.
Tecno Spark 40C leads on battery. Tecno Spark 30 5G carries a 5000 mAh cell and Tecno Spark 40C a 6000 mAh cell, with 18W and 18W wired charging respectively.
